JOB SUMMARY

The City of Baltimore Department of Human Resources seeks a dynamic thought leader to serve as its Chief of Engagement and Strategic Partnership. The successful incumbent will serve as the lead for Citywide initiatives related to employee engagement, and human resources continuous improvement through stakeholder feedback. The role will work across all functional areas of DHR and collaborate with agencies across City government to elevate their performance and address their unique needs through strategic HR partnership. The successful candidate will lead a team of employee engagement professionals to execute strategic programs, support DHR initiatives and maintain the upmost integrity.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Serves as the primary point of contact for enterprise-wide engagement socialization and presentation, representing DHR leadership at events and forums related to engagement activities.
  • Develop long-term strategies and sponsors key initiatives to promote and achieve a culture of service excellence and employee engagement.
  • Lead projects to apply established business process improvement methods to define, measure, analyze, improve, and control to standardize and improve Citywide human resources business processes and procedures.
  • Collects timely data to support employee engagement initiatives through focus groups, surveys, town halls, one-on-one interviews, and other methodology; evaluates and applies the data to support decisions.
  • Strategically collaborates with and builds relationships across DHR offices, city agencies and key external stakeholders.
  • Utilize demographic data to engage with city agencies and develop human resource strategies to increase internal diversity, equity and inclusion.
  • Responsible for managing systems, processes, timelines and metrics for Performance Development to include managing the annual planning calendar and activities.
